What is a Hydrocele?

A hydrocele is when fluid builds up in the scrotum and causes it to swell. It’s more common in adult men. It usually isn’t painful and can be found during a check-up or by a doctor.

The scrotum is a bag that holds the testicles. It can get bigger because of injury, infection, or sometimes from birth. This swelling might need surgery to fix it, especially in adults.

You can see a hydrocele by the big size of the scrotum that might change during the day. It isn’t usually painful, but it can feel heavy. If you spot this early, treatment can be easier.

Hydrocele Diagnosis for Adults

Diagnosing a hydrocele in adults takes several important steps. These steps are key for right detection and best treatment planning. Knowing these steps helps patients get ready for their diagnostic trip.

Physical Examination by a Specialist

The first step to diagnose a hydrocele is a check by an expert. They feel the scrotum to look for swelling and fluid. This check is very important. It helps decide the next steps, like what tests might be needed.

Ultrasound Imaging

Using hydrocele ultrasound imaging is non-intrusive. It’s used to confirm the diagnosis. This method shows a deep look at the scrotum. It helps doctors know if it’s a hydrocele or something else, like a tumor. It also helps see how big the fluid is.

Other Diagnostic Tests

Sometimes, more tests are needed to be really sure. These tests might be blood tests, urine tests, or a CT scan. If they think there’s more going on, these tests help find out. Then, doctors can choose the best hydrocele management options together with the patient.

Watchful Waiting for Hydrocele

If the hydrocele isn’t causing pain or serious problems, you may just need to watch it. Doctors might suggest you keep an eye on it. You would have regular check-ups. This is a simple and safe option for many.

Hydrocele Aspiration Procedure

Hydrocele aspiration is about taking out the fluid with a needle. A numbing medicine is used, and the fluid is removed. This gives quick help for the swelling and pain. It’s good for those who don’t want surgery but still suffer.

Sclerotherapy for Hydrocele

Sclerotherapy injects a special liquid into the hydrocele. This liquid irritates it, making it shut and stop the fluid build-up. It’s a lasting solution for persistent hydroceles without needing surgery.

Here is a table about the pros and cons of each non-surgical hydrocele treatment:

Treatment Option Advantages Considerations
Watchful Waiting Low-risk, no immediate intervention required Requires regular monitoring, may not alleviate symptoms
Hydrocele Aspiration Quick relief, minimally invasive Possible recurrence of hydrocele
Sclerotherapy Non-surgical, long-term results Potential for minor side effects, multiple sessions may be needed

Types of Surgical Techniques

Doctors use various methods to treat hydroceles. The choice depends on the hydrocele’s size and the patient’s health. Let’s talk about the main types of surgery:

  • Open Surgery – A cut is made in the scrotum to remove the hydrocele sac. This is a common and highly effective method.
  • Endoscopic Surgery – A small camera and tools go in through tiny cuts. This method means a quicker recovery and less pain after.
  • Drainage and Sclerotherapy – Fluid is drained, and then a medicine is put in to stop it from coming back. It’s not surgery, but it aims to treat the hydrocele.

Each surgery type has its own benefits. Doctors pick the best one for each patient.

Hydrocele Surgery Recovery Tips

Recovering from hydrocele surgery has key steps for a fast return to normal. It’s essential to take care after the operation to avoid problems and help the healing.

First, you need to get lots of rest in the days right after the surgery. Don’t do hard activities. Follow what your doctor says about lifting and moving heavy things.

Taking care of the pain is also very important. You can use over-the-counter pain medicines or ones your doctor prescribes. Ice packs on the area can help with swelling and pain. Make sure to put a cloth between the ice pack and your skin.

Watching out for any issues is crucial too. Look for things like more swelling than usual, redness, fever, or fluid from the cut. Tell your doctor right away if you see any of these signs.

Keeping clean is very important after the surgery. Make sure the area stays dry and doesn’t get dirty, to avoid infections. Your surgeon will tell you how to look after the cut. They will also say when it’s okay to take a bath or shower.

You can start walking a bit, but don’t do too much at first. Walking a little is good for your health and helps prevent blood clots. But, don’t do sports or heavy work until your doctor says it’s okay.

In short, recovering from hydrocele surgery well means getting enough rest, managing pain, watching for issues, keeping clean, and slowly going back to usual activities. Doing these things will make your recovery better and quicker.

Factors Affecting Treatment Cost

The cost of getting rid of a hydrocele can change a lot. Let’s look at what makes the price go up or down:

  • Type of Treatment: You can pick from simple ways like draining to surgery. Each way costs different.
  • Healthcare Provider: The cost may change with where the doctor is and how good he or she is.
  • Facility Fees: Public places usually cost less than private ones. Where you go makes a difference.
  • Post-Treatment Care: Needing more visits, medicine, or treatments will add to the final bill.
